Introduction

The Bosch GSB 18V-21 Professional is a cordless combi drill with impact drilling function. It is powered by an 18V battery and is designed for a variety of applications, including drilling in wood, metal, and masonry, as well as driving screws. The drill features a full-metal gear box and Electronic Cell Protection, which provide professional quality and durability. It also has a keyless 13-mm chuck and a LED work light.

Comparison to Bosch GSR drills:

The Bosch GSR drills are designed for screwing in and loosening screws, as well as for drilling in wood, metal, ceramic, and plastic. The Bosch GSB drills are designed for the same tasks, but they also have an impact drilling function, which allows them to drill into masonry.

The main difference between the Bosch GSR and GSB drills is the impact drilling function. If you need to drill into masonry, then the Bosch GSB drill is the better option. However, if you don't need the impact drilling function, then the Bosch GSR drill is a good choice.
